Ingredients for this Spicy Cajun Chicken Linguine
For the Cajun Chicken:
- 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 tablespoons Cajun seasoning
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
For the Creamy Garlic Parmesan Sauce:
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 4 garlic cloves, minced
- 1½ cups heavy cream
- 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- ½ te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ional, for extra heat)
For the Pasta:
- 8 oz linguine pasta
- Salt for boiling water
Garnish:
- Chopped fresh parsley (optional)

Step 1: Cook the Pasta
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the linguine and cook until al dente according to package instructions. Reserve 1/2 cup of pasta water before draining. Set pasta aside.
Step 2: Season and Cook the Chicken
Rub the chicken breasts with Cajun seasoning until evenly coated.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the chicken breasts for 5-6 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through. Remove from pan and let rest for a few minutes before slicing into strips.
Step 3: Make the Garlic Parmesan Sauce
In the same skillet, reduce heat to medium. Melt the butter and add minced garlic. Cook for 1 minute until fragrant. Pour in the heavy cream and stir well. Allow to simmer for 3-4 minutes until it slightly thickens.
Add the Parmesan cheese gradually, stirring until melted and the sauce becomes smooth. Season with sal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es if using. If the sauce is too thick, stir in a bit of reserved pasta water until desired consistency is reached.
Step 4: Combine and Serve
Add the cooked linguine to the sauce and toss until evenly coated. Plate the pasta and top with sliced Cajun chicken.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ley if desired. Serve hot and enjoy the creamy, spicy magic!
Frequently Asked Questions
How spicy is this dish?
The heat level is moderate, coming mostly from the Cajun seasoning and optional red pepper flakes. Adjust the spice level by reducing or omitting the red pepper flakes.
Can I use a different type of pasta?
Yes! Fettuccine, penne, or even spaghetti work well if you don’t have linguine on hand.
What if I don’t have Cajun seasoning?
You can make a quick blend using pa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, cayenne, thyme, and oregano. Mix to taste.
Can I use pre-cooked chicken?
Certainly. Just slice and heat the chicken before adding it to the final dish. You’ll lose a bit of the fresh sear flavor, but it still works in a pinch.
Is there a dairy-free version?
Swap out the heavy cream with unsweetened coconut cream and use nutritional yeast in place of Parmesan. It changes the flavor profile, but keeps it creamy.
How can I add vegetables to this recipe?
Toss in spinach, bell peppers, or sun-dried tomatoes when you add the garlic. They blend seamlessly into the creamy sauce.
